Abstract
The utility model discloses a novel basketball stand for teaching, which comprises a base, wherein a telescopic cylinder is arranged on the base, an adjusting rod is arranged in the telescopic cylinder in a rotating way, the adjusting rod is connected with a rotating motor through a transmission gear, meanwhile, the adjusting rod is also connected with a telescopic rod with a rectangular cross section through screw threads, and one end of the telescopic rod is connected with a backboard; the utility model discloses it is rotatory to drive the regulation pole through rotating the motor when using, because the cross section of telescopic link is the rectangle, consequently adjusts the pole and drives the telescopic link slip at the rotation in-process, realizes the regulation of backboard height, the utility model discloses a backboard height can be adjusted as required in a flexible way to make the student of different age brackets all can suitably develop the basketball teaching activity, be favorable to the popularization of basketball campaign, improved basketball stands's application scope and rate of utilization simultaneously greatly, reduced the idle time of equipment.

Detailed Description
The invention will be further illustrated by the following specific examples:
example 1
The embodiment is taken as the best embodiment of the utility model, and discloses a novel basketball stand for teaching, the specific structure is shown in fig. 1, the basketball stand comprises a base 1, a roller 16, a storage battery 9 and a controller 2 are arranged on the base 1, a telescopic cylinder 4 is fixedly arranged on the base 1, a telescopic rod 7 is arranged in the telescopic cylinder 4 in a sliding manner through a sliding pair, and the cross section of the telescopic rod 7 is rectangular or square; an adjusting rod 5 is rotatably arranged in the telescopic cylinder 4 through a plane bearing 20, the adjusting rod 5 is in threaded connection with a telescopic rod 7, a rotating motor 3 is further arranged on the base 1, the rotating motor 3 is a direct current motor, a connecting groove 21 is formed in the telescopic cylinder 4, a transmission gear 6 is arranged on the rotating motor 3, and the transmission gear 6 penetrates through the connecting groove 21 to be meshed with a transmission gear on the adjusting rod 5; a brake rod 10 is further screwed on the upper part of the telescopic cylinder 4, a rubber brake pad 12 is arranged at one end of the brake rod 10, which is in contact with the telescopic rod 5, the other end of the brake rod meets the outside of the telescopic cylinder 4, and a rotating wheel 11 is arranged on the brake rod 10 at the end; the opening end of the telescopic cylinder 4 is provided with a sealing end cover 22 and a sliding groove 12; the telescopic cylinder 4 is also provided with a limiting groove 17, the telescopic rod 5 is in screw thread connection with a limiting rod 18, the limiting rod 18 is inserted into the limiting groove 17, so that the stroke of the telescopic rod 5 is controlled, and meanwhile, the top end of the limiting groove 17 is also provided with a stroke switch 19; a backboard 8 is fixedly installed at the top end of the telescopic rod 7, a basket is arranged on the backboard 8, a storage battery 9 is also arranged on the rear side of the base 1, the center of gravity of the basketball stand is changed while power is supplied, and therefore stability of equipment is guaranteed; an infrared sensor 15 is further arranged on the base 1, and a signal transmitting port of the infrared sensor 15 is opposite to the bottom surface of the backboard 8; the controller 2 adopts a single chip microcomputer or a PLC, wherein the inlet end of the controller 2 is respectively connected with the storage battery 9, the infrared sensor 15 and the travel switch 19, and the output end of the controller 2 is connected with the rotating motor 11.
The utility model discloses start through the controller when needing to use and rotate the motor, it is rotatory to rotate the motor and drive the regulation pole, because the cross section of telescopic link is rectangle or square, adjusts the pole simultaneously and is connected with the telescopic link screw thread, therefore the telescopic link realizes ascending or descending motion under the drive of adjusting the pole to change basketball stands's height, simultaneously through infrared ray sensor survey basketball stands's height, when reacing preset's gear, controller automatic control rotates the motor and shuts down, the utility model discloses an to basketball stands height's automatically regulated, expanded basketball stands's application scope greatly.
